Neptune Square Descendant
Devotion needs edges
Neptune square the Descendant sets longing and compassion against the reality of relationship agreements. You may meet others through a subtle mist—drawn to soulfulness, mystery, or need—while the square asks for clarity that love alone cannot supply. This tension becomes a lifelong practice of marrying tenderness with truth.
Strengths & Challenges
Strengths
- Compassionate presence — instinctively senses what others feel and need.
- Inspired partnership — brings imagination, artistry, and spiritual depth to bonds.
- Redemptive hope — believes in people's potential and invites healing.
Challenges
- Foggy agreements — unclear expectations create confusion or disappointment.
- Savior-martyr loops — over-helping or attracting the ungrounded or unavailable.
- Disillusion cycles — idealization followed by withdrawal or guilt.

With Neptune squaring the Descendant, the meeting place between you and the other is tender, porous, and sometimes slippery. There can be a reflex to see what is possible in someone rather than what is present, to fall in love with an essence while overlooking the edges. Empathy pulls you close; ambiguity invites you to guess. Partners may appear as muses, waifs, healers, or mysteries—people who stir your devotion, or who need it. The square indicates friction: the pull to dissolve into union vies with the need for clear terms. Projection becomes part of the story—you discover your own idealism, wounds, and yearnings reflected in their eyes.
Over time, this aspect matures by turning enchantment into stewardship. You learn that love is not proven by sacrifice, and that boundaries are the vessels that let compassion actually nourish. The practice is simple and courageous: ask for definitions, name needs out loud, and let time test chemistry. Romance doesn’t have to vanish when the fog lifts; it can become more trustworthy. As your discernment grows, you shift from rescuing to respecting, from chasing potential to cherishing reality. What remains is a kind of love that holds both the ocean and the shore.
Life Areas & Expression
Relationships & Intimacy
You may be drawn to partners who feel otherworldly, wounded, artistic, or somehow out of reach. Real intimacy emerges when you translate feeling into form—clear agreements, transparent motives, and gentle reality checks that keep the connection honest.
Work & Collaboration
In teams, you bring imagination and heart, often sensing the unspoken climate of a room. Role drift and over-functioning are risks; naming responsibilities, deadlines, and scope turns inspiration into results without resentment.
Self-Image & Boundaries
Others may project savior, dreamer, or even scapegoat onto you, which can blur your sense of self. Grounding in body signals, routines, and clear no’s helps you stay present while letting people hold their own pictures.
